首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否在CSR创建过程中为签名证书生成私钥?

在CSR(Certificate Signing Request,证书签名请求)创建过程中,是需要生成私钥的。私钥是用于加密和解密数据的关键部分,它是非对称加密算法中的一部分。在创建CSR时,首先会生成一对密钥,包括公钥和私钥。私钥是保密的,用于对数据进行加密和签名,而公钥则可以公开,用于解密和验证签名。

在创建CSR时,私钥的生成是在本地进行的,不会被发送到证书颁发机构(CA)或其他任何地方。私钥的生成通常是由证书申请者的服务器或应用程序自动生成的,然后将公钥包含在CSR中,以便向CA申请签名证书。

生成私钥的过程通常使用安全的随机数生成器来确保私钥的随机性和安全性。私钥应该妥善保管,只有证书持有者才能访问私钥,以确保证书的安全性和完整性。

腾讯云提供了SSL证书服务,可以帮助用户生成CSR并签发证书。您可以通过腾讯云SSL证书服务了解更多相关信息:https://cloud.tencent.com/product/ssl

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• SSL证书生成流程

    SSL证书通过在客户端浏览器和Web服务器之间建立一条SSL安全通道(Secure socketlayer(SSL),SSL安全协议主要用来提供对用户和服务器的认证;对传送的数据进行加密和隐藏;确保数据在传送中不被改变,即数据的完整性,现已成为该领域中全球化的标准。由于SSL技术已建立到所有主要的浏览器和WEB服务器程序中,因此,仅需安装服务器证书就可以激活该功能了)。即通过它可以激活SSL协议,实现数据信息在客户端和服务器之间的加密传输,可以防止数据信息的泄露。保证了双方传递信息的安全性,而且用户可以通过服务器证书验证他所访问的网站是否是真实可靠。 SSL网站不同于一般的Web站点,它使用的是“HTTPS”协议,而不是普通的“HTTP”协议。因此它的URL(统一资源定位器)格式为“https://www.baidu.com”。

    02

    数字证书系列--证书请求文件CSR

    用比较通俗的例子来理解证书请求文件: 比如我自己的网站,需要使用https 通信,那么我向“证书机构”申请数字证书的时候,就需要向他们提供相应的信息,这些信息以特定文件格式(.csr)提供的,这个文件就是“证书请求文件”;为了确保我提供的信息在互联网的传输过程中不会被有意或者无意的破坏掉,我们有如下的机制来对传输的内容进行保护:首先在本地生成一个私钥,利用这个私钥对“我们需要提供的信息“进行加密,从而生成 证书请求文件(.csr), 这个证书请求文件其实就是私钥对应的公钥证书的原始文件,里面含有对应的公钥信息; 这一系列听起来很复杂,不过我们有很多工具可以用,Linux下常用openssl 命令来实现:

    02
    领券